What is Sustainable Fashion?
Sustainable fashion is a way of designing, making, and using clothes that is friendly to the environment and fair to people. It focuses on reducing harm caused by the fashion industry. This includes using eco-friendly materials, saving natural resources, and making sure workers are treated ethically.
In simple words, sustainable fashion means choosing clothes that last longer and do not damage the planet. It avoids overproduction and waste, which are common problems in fast fashion. Instead of making cheap clothes in large amounts, it supports quality products that can be reused, repaired, or recycled.

Eco-Friendly Materials
Eco-friendly materials are fabrics that cause less harm to the environment. These include organic cotton, hemp, bamboo, and recycled fibers. They use fewer chemicals, less water, and produce less pollution. Choosing these materials helps reduce environmental damage and supports a cleaner production process. They are also safer for both workers and consumers.
Ethical Production
Ethical production means making clothes in fair and safe working conditions. Workers should get fair wages and proper treatment. Factories should avoid child labor and unsafe environments. Brands must be transparent about their supply chain. This ensures that clothing is not only good for customers but also respectful to the people who make it.
Circular Fashion
Circular fashion means reusing clothes instead of throwing them away. It includes recycling, repairing, and upcycling old garments. This reduces textile waste and saves resources. Clothes are designed to last longer and stay in use for many years. It helps create a system where nothing is wasted and everything is reused effectively.

Slow Fashion Movement
The slow fashion movement focuses on quality instead of quantity. It encourages people to buy fewer clothes that last longer. Instead of following fast-changing trends, it promotes timeless styles. This helps reduce waste and overproduction. Slow fashion also supports ethical brands that care about the environment and workers. It is a more responsible way of consuming fashion.
Thrift and Second-Hand Shopping
Thrift and second-hand shopping are becoming very popular. People buy used clothes instead of new ones to reduce waste. This trend helps save money and protect the environment. It also gives old clothes a new life. Many online platforms and thrift stores make it easy to find stylish second-hand outfits. It reduces demand for fast fashion production.
Capsule Wardrobe Trend
A capsule wardrobe means owning a small number of essential clothing items. These clothes can be mixed and matched easily. It reduces clutter and encourages smart buying. People focus on simple, versatile outfits instead of excess clothing. This trend saves money, time, and space. It also supports a more sustainable and mindful lifestyle.

Patagonia
Patagonia is one of the most well-known sustainable fashion brands. It uses recycled materials and promotes repairing and reusing clothes instead of throwing them away. The brand is also strongly involved in environmental activism. Its focus is on durability, meaning customers can wear products for many years. Patagonia encourages people to buy less and choose quality over quantity.

Reformation
Reformation is popular for trendy and modern clothing made in a sustainable way. The brand uses eco-friendly fabrics like Tencel and recycled materials. It also tracks its environmental impact and shares it with customers. Reformation focuses on stylish designs while reducing waste and carbon emissions. It is especially popular among younger consumers who want fashionable yet responsible clothing.
Levi’s
Levi’s is a famous denim brand that has improved its sustainability practices. It uses water-saving techniques in production and recycled materials in its jeans. The brand also encourages customers to recycle old denim. Levi’s focuses on making durable clothing that lasts longer, reducing the need for constant replacement and helping lower environmental impact.
Adidas
Adidas is a global sportswear brand working toward sustainability. It uses recycled plastic waste to create shoes and clothing. The brand is also investing in eco-friendly innovation and reducing carbon emissions. Adidas aims to make performance wear more sustainable without reducing quality or comfort. It is one of the biggest brands pushing change in the sportswear industry.
How to Build a Sustainable Wardrobe
Building a sustainable fashion wardrobe means choosing clothes that are better for the environment and last longer. It is not about buying many clothes, but about making smart choices. A sustainable wardrobe helps reduce waste, saves money, and supports ethical brands. It also encourages people to think before buying and avoid unnecessary shopping.
To build a better wardrobe, you need to focus on quality, reuse, and responsibility. Small changes in your shopping habits can make a big difference. Over time, your clothing choices can help reduce pollution and support a cleaner fashion industry. Below are some simple and practical ways to start building a sustainable wardrobe.
- Buy fewer but better clothes: Choose high-quality items that last longer instead of cheap fast fashion pieces. This reduces waste and saves money in the long run.
- Choose natural fabrics: Prefer cotton, hemp, or bamboo materials because they are eco-friendly and safer for the environment.
- Recycle and repair clothes: Fix torn clothes instead of throwing them away, and donate items you no longer wear.
- Shop second-hand: Buying used clothes reduces demand for new production and helps reduce environmental impact.

Frequently Asked Questions
What is the main goal of sustainable fashion?
The main goal of sustainable fashion is to reduce environmental damage by using eco-friendly materials and ethical production methods while promoting long-lasting clothing.
How does sustainable fashion help the environment?
It helps by reducing water waste, lowering carbon emissions, and decreasing textile pollution through recycling, reuse, and better manufacturing practices.
What is the difference between sustainable fashion and fast fashion?
Fast fashion focuses on cheap, quickly made clothes, while sustainable fashion focuses on quality, durability, and environmentally friendly production.
Can sustainable fashion be affordable for everyone?
Yes, it can be affordable by buying second-hand clothes, choosing minimal wardrobes, and investing in long-lasting pieces instead of frequent shopping.
Why is ethical production important in fashion?
Ethical production ensures workers are treated fairly, receive proper wages, and work in safe conditions, making the fashion industry more responsible and human-friendly.
